DS leader: Elections are in sight

“The country has taken several steps back. The economy is slowly dying out and the government does not know how to strengthen the economy and it is sliding toward a recession,” Đilas told daily Večernje novosti and assessed that differences in the ruling coalition were “irreconcilable” and that they “are paralyzing the state”.

When asked if he was ready to form a coalition with Serbian Progressive Party (SNS) leader Aleksandar Vučić, he said that “the story is launched by (United Regions of Serbia leader Mlađan) Dinkić and (Socialist Party of Serbia leader Ivica) Dačić”.

“It is only illogical that they claim at the same time that there will be no elections. I do not understand how a coalition is being prepared if there will be no elections. The DS will go to the elections with a new program and we cannot make coalition with anyone who is not ready to share basic values we will advocate. I am not interested in the names of the parties,” the DS leader pointed out.
